Ruby
Even dynamic languages such as Ruby give you instant access to your com-
puter s serial port and to an Arduino connected to it. But before that, you
need to install the serialport gem:
maik>
gem install serialport
Using it, you can connect to the Arduino in just 30 lines of code.
